Ferrari’s Lewis Hamilton continued the team’s momentum in FP2 at the 2026 F1 Monaco GP, full results below.
During FP1, home hero Charles Leclerc found his way to the top of the timings by the end of the session, with Lewis Hamilton and Max Verstappen rounding out the top three. As drivers left the pit lane, the majority of the field opted for the medium compound tyres, with the exception of the Aston Martins of Fernando Alonso and Lance Stroll. After his crash in FP1, Red Bull completed an impressive repair effort on Isack Hadjar’s car, allowing the Frenchman to rejoin the rest of the field on track.
Coming out of the tunnel and heading straight into the run-off area, Lando Norris found himself hopping out of his car, ending his session prematurely. The incident deployed a virtual safety car, as the issue identified with Norris’ car was battery-related. While drivers continued to acclimatise to the track and its conditions, a fight at the top between Leclerc and Hamilton continued.
With thirty minutes remaining on the clock, the field was split between tyre compounds, with some drivers still on mediums while others had switched to the softs. However, building on their pace from FP1, the Ferraris continued to look strong.
Heading down to Sainte Devote, Franco Colapinto locked up and sustained damage to his car, but managed to limp back to the pit lane. As the closing stages of the session approached, the entire field was on the soft tyres. With three minutes left on the clock, a late red flag was deployed after Sergio Perez’s brakes caught fire, marking the end of the session.
2026 F1 Monaco GP | FP2 results
- Hamilton 1:13.026
- Leclerc 1:13.137
- Verstappen 1:13.194
- Russell 1:13.405
- Antonelli 1:13.529
- Hadjar 1:14.087
- Piastri 1:14.088
- Hülkenberg 1:14.094
- Bortoleto 1:14.359
- Bearman 1:14.456
- Gasly 1:14.497
- Sainz 1:14.512
- Albon 1:14.600
- Lindblad 1:14.748
- Colapinto 1:14.758
- Lawson 1:14.785
- Ocon 1:14.845
- Perez 1:15.116
- Norris 1:15.274
- Alonso 1:15.294
- Bottas 1:15.759
- Stroll 1:16.174
